A visit to the Moravský kras nature reserve is a must for all nature lovers. It is the largest limestone area in the Czech Republic rich in the typical karst features – caves adorned with stalagmites and stalactites, underground passages, disappearing rivers, and underground lakes.
The Macocha Abyss, 138m deep, and the caves – the Punkevní, Balcarka, Kateřinská and Sloupsko – Šošůvské jeskyně – are the most attractive natural beauty spots of the limestone area.
